The State Archives of Vicenza hold the following fonds:

Civil Status of the Department of the Bacchiglione, the Napoleonic Civil Status from 1806 to 1815 of the municipalities included in the following cantons of the Napoleonic Department of the Bacchiglione is preserved:
District I of Vicenza: canton I of Vicenza; canton II of Camisano; canton III of Arzignano; canton IV of Valdagno; canton V of Barbarano
District II of Schio: canton I of Schio; canton II of Tiene; canton III of Malo
District III of Bassano: canton I of Bassano; canton III of Marostica
District IV of Asiago: Canton I of Asiago
For the department of Brenta, the Napoleonic civil status of the canton of Cittadella, in the current Province of Padua, is preserved.

Italian Civil Status: the Vicenza State Archives hold the Italian Civil Status of the municipalities in the province of Vicenza from 1 September 1871 to 1906, with documents up to 1950. Digital reproductions of the attachments of Citizenships, Marriages, Marriage Publications, Births and Deaths are published on the Ancestor Portal.

The remaining part of the fund for the years 1906 – 1963 was paid by the Court of Vicenza in 2020 and is currently deposited at the State Archives of Verona. Digital reproductions of documents on deposit in Verona are available, within the limits established by current legislation on the processing of personal data, at the Study Room of the State Archives in Vicenza.

The Recruitment Lists are filed in two archives:

Conscription lists of VicenzaThe conscription lists (classes 1848 – 1946) registered in the municipalities of the entire province of Vicenza are preserved.

– Conscription lists of Vicenza conscription (classes 1806-1862) in the municipalities of Vicenza district only;

The personal information appears in these lists only from the 1873 class on. This information is particularly useful for genealogic research, since it contains the names of the parents and the birthplace.

Matriculation sheets and roles

The Vicenza Draft Cards file holds the Draft Cards and military records (classes of 1850-1931) of the privates and non-commissioned officers.

There is also an envelope of Air Force personnel files relating to the classes from 1893 to 1902 and documentation on women who were recognised as ‘partisans‘.

Online Sources.

The Institute provides a database for the consultation of military conscription lists for the classes 1873-1901 and matriculation rolls for the classes 1892; 1897; 1898; 1899; 1914. In addition, a database is available with the list of notaries whose deeds are kept in the State Archives or in the Bassano del Grappa Archive Section. They cover a chronological span from 1361 to 1914 and concern localities in the current province of Vicenza and some municipalities in the provinces of Treviso (Asolo and Castelfranco), Belluno (Quero and Fener), Padua (Cittadella) and Venice (Noale). Another database concerning wills from 1408 to around 1850 from the Acts of the Notaries of Vicenza. There were 6136 notaries active in the district of Vicenza between the years 1359 and 1914. The documentary production packaged in registers, volumes, files and cassettes occupies a linear space of more than 600 metres in the State Archives’ repositories.

The State Archives Section of Imola preserves the registers of the Napoleonic Civil Status(birth, marriage, death acts and attachments) produced from 1806 to 1815 by the Municipalities of the Reno Department – Imola District (Cantons of Imola, Castel San Pietro, Fontana and Lugo).

The file Ferrara Province Recruitment Office holds the Recruitment Lists (classes of 1839-1944), the Extraction lists and the Outcome of the draft examination of all the cities of the province.

Matriculation sheets and roles

The information about the military service and campaigns of the recruits is held at the Bologna State Archive, at the Military District file(1862-1920). For Ferrara, the available files are those from 1876 to 1920. For Ferrara from 1876 to 1944.

The Trani State Archives Section preserves the fund of the Civil Registry (1901-1938) paid by the Court of Trani for the district: Andria; Barletta; Bisceglie; Canosa di Puglia; Corato; Minervino; Molfetta; Ruvo di Puglia; Spinazzola; Terlizzi e Trani.

The Isernia State Archive holds the Civil Registry files, which are subdivided in: Civil Registry (1809-1865). The Campobasso State Archive transferred the files in 1972. It sent the marriage and death certificates, the documents necessary to issue the marriage certificate (the so-called marriage processes) and the marriage announcements, as well as the “different acts”, which, through different laws, were in force since 1812. These documents are duplicates, the second copy that was sent to the Isernia Court. Most of the registries are gathered in parchment books. Civil Registry(1866-1940), which holds the Civil Registry files and the attached files from the Isernia Court, which received the second copy of the certificates. IThe documents were part of a broader ensemble of files sent by the Isernia City Hall, since the Court was set at the City Hall building, over the S. Francis Monastry, until the 1970s. IThe archive has been preserved in envelopes and it’s composed of Civil Registry and attached filesseries. It includes all cities from the Isernia Province (except Longano) and some cities from the Avellino, Campobasso, Caserta, and Naples provinces. The Forlì del Sannio Civil Registry file (1875-1899) holds the death and marriage certificates from that city.

Army census

Following the establishment of the province of Isernia, the series of Recruitment Registers (1844-1917) consisting of the extraction lists of members drawn by lot by the Municipalities and the recruitment lists drawn up by the Municipalities for each year or age class. The Campobasso State Archive transferred the files in 1972

The Trieste State Archive holds the Civil Registry of Trieste(1924-1944), which is composed of the duplicates of the Civil Registry files and the attached files, previously preserved in the Trieste District Court. All cities in the province are included in this file, even those given to Yugoslavia after the 1947 peace treaty.

Draft lists

The Institute holds the following files:

The Institute holds the following files: – Military records of the Austro-Hungarian Empire, which includes the Recruitment Lists (classes of 1850-1900);

Trieste conscription office for conscription lists (classes 1899-1948);

Trieste Harbormaster, for the Trieste Navy Recruitment Lists (classes of 1901-1925) and for the Montefalcone district as well (classes of 1931-1934).

Matriculation sheets and roles

The Institute holds the following files:

Military records of the Austro-Hungarian Empire, which includes the Draft Cards and military records (classes of 1850-1900);

Trieste military district for matricular rolls with records of service rendered, war campaigns, corps of assignment until discharge (1858-1948).

Online Sources.

The Trieste State Archives have made numerous digitisations available, including that of the matriculation sheets military district of Pola and Trieste, in which it is possible to search from the bottom, identifying the series (year) and then arriving at the name of the person sought (the names are all listed alphabetically).

The Catania State Archives hold the fonds of the Civil Status of Catania and Province (1820-1893). Ferdinand I, King of the Two Sicilies, established the Civil Registry in 1819. Ferdinand I, King of the Two Sicilies, established the Civil Registry in 1819. The fund includes material produced in the Bourbon period and later in the Unification period, the modus operandi of municipalities remained virtually unchanged. Civil registrars compiled the following registers: deeds of legitimate births, deeds of illegitimate births or projets, memoranda, marriage deeds or solemn promises, death certificates and miscellaneous deeds. At the same time, the attachments to birth certificates, marriage certificates, etc. were collected in files. By Royal Decree of 15 November 1865, the new order was introduced, which provided for the compilation of citizenship registers, but did away with registers of miscellaneous deeds.

For the period 1820-1865, documentation is preserved from the civil status of Catania (but only from 1841 to 1865) and the municipalities subject to the Catania Intendency. Also included in this series was material relating to the localities now in the province of Enna (established in 1927): Assoro, Carcaci, Catenanuova, Centuripe, Gagliano, Leonforte, Nicosia, Nissoria, Regalbuto, Sperlinga and Troina. This documentation was transferred to the Enna State Archives in 2013.

Between 1866 and 1893 only the registries from the Catania province are available, except those of Caltagirone, Grammichele, Militello, Mineo, Mirabella, Palagonia, Raddusa, Ramacca, S. Cono, S. M. de Ganzeria, Vizzini.

– List of conscription (1840-1948).

The Catania Military District Fund (1840-1890) holds:

List of conscription (1840-1948). The series also includes material from the pre-unification era. In addition to the conscription lists for the period from 1840 to 1890, there are extraction registers. For the period 1844-1891, the registers of the minutes of the ordinary meetings of the conscription councils and the general lists of deserters are also available.

The Catania Harbour Master’s Fund includes the conscription lists of enlisted personnel in the Navy and consists of 94 registers relating to the 1936-85 conscription classes. The fund can be consulted by means of payment lists broken down by year produced by the institution itself.

Matriculation sheets and roles

The file Catania Military District holds:

Matriculation rolls (1871-1889) (includes draft classes 1871, 1877, 1880, 1887, 1889). For searches in the registers we use an alphabetical repertory consisting of a list of names and their matriculation numbers, subdivided by year. The same research tools are available online.

Personal files of military personnel (1862-1900). This substantial core was joined in 2013 and 2016 by a further 360 files with documentation of military personnel from the classes of 1876 to 1898, supplementing the original collection. The files are sorted by class of birth. The search is carried out by means of various consultation tools structured according to the year of extraction and the alphabetical list of names of the military personnel whose file is held. The same lists are available online.

The Lecce State Archive holds the Civil Registry files (1809-1941), which contain the birth, marriage, death and citizenship certificates (the last since 1866), issued by duplicate by the Civil Registry office of the cities of the Lecce province.

Draft lists

The Military District Fund of Lecce and Taranto (classes 1844-1925) and the Levy Office of Lecce (classes 1871-1942) conserve the draft lists in the district.

Matriculation sheets and roles

The Military District Fund of Lecce and Taranto (classes 1844-1925) and the Levy Office of Lecce (classes 1871-1942) conserve matricular rolls in the district.

The Latina State Archive holds the Civil Registry files (1867-2000), which have been recently sent by the Latina Court and include documents from some of the cities of the province.

Army census

The Gaeta Harbormaster file holds the Navy Recruitment Lists, which contain information about the recruits born between 1900 and 1930.

The Latina Military District (classes of 1876-1925) and Rome Military District (classes of 1854-1947) hold the Recruitment Listsof the cities of the Latina province.

Recruitment number and military draw number

The Latina Military District (classes of 1876-1925) and Rome Military District (classes of 1854-1944) hold the Draft Cardsof the cities of the Latina province.

Online Sources

The institute has also set up a specific database on the gli operai della bonifica pontina associated with the 58.852 workers employed by the Piscinara di Littoria Land Reclamation Consortium from 1926 to 1949.

The La Spezia State Archive holds the Archive Civil status – Parish books of the La Spezia municipalities from 1838 to 1857; Civil status of the municipality of Corradano 1806 to 1814 and 1838 to 1865 (parish registers); Civil Status of Varese Ligure, from 1780 to 1859, with the statistics and census series (1837-1945). The fonds, with inventories, are freely accessible.

Draft lists

The Recruitment Lists are divided in two sections: Army (classes of 1848-1935); and Navy (classes of 1887-1985).

Online Sources.

A database of the Navy recruits of the 1888-1900 classes and the 1848-1863 classes of the Army is available at this Institute.
